This pull request modernizes the project's logging system by migrating from older Cosmos SDK and Zerolog implementations to ipfs/go-log/v2. This change streamlines the logging approach, updates module dependencies, and adapts the codebase to a more consistent and flexible logging API, improving maintainability and potentially performance by reducing the dependency footprint.
Highlights
- Logging Library Migration: The core change in this pull request is the comprehensive migration of the project's logging infrastructure from
cosmossdk.io/logandgithub.com/rs/zerologtogithub.com/ipfs/go-log/v2. This impacts nearly all modules and tests. - Dependency Management Updates: All relevant
go.modandgo.sumfiles across theapps,da,sequencers, and root modules have been updated. This includes removing the old logging libraries and their now-unnecessary transitive dependencies, and addinggithub.com/ipfs/go-log/v2(andgo.uber.org/zapwhere it became a direct dependency). - Logging API Adaptation: The code has been refactored to align with the
ipfs/go-log/v2API. This involves changes to how loggers are instantiated (e.g., usinglogging.Logger("ModuleName")for named loggers instead oflogger.With("module", "...")), and adapting log method calls to its variadic argument style for key-value pairs. - Test Infrastructure Adjustments: The mock logger implementations and test setups have been updated to correctly interact with the new
ipfs/go-log/v2interface. This ensures that existing tests continue to function as expected and that logging behavior can be properly asserted.

The code changes migrate the logging library from cosmossdk.io/log to ipfs/go-log/v2. The changes are consistent and correctly adopt the new logging library's patterns, such as using named loggers for different subsystems. However, several tests have been weakened by removing specific assertions on log messages, and the MockLogger implementation in block/test_utils.go has a type mismatch that will cause compilation failures. I've also noted a potential feature regression where the stack trace logging option (--log.trace) is no longer supported.

This commit migrates Rollkit's logging from cosmossdk.io/log to github.com/ipfs/go-log/v2.
Key changes include:
- Updated the central SetupLogger function to use ipfs/go-log/v2.
- Replaced cosmossdk.io/log imports and usage with ipfs/go-log/v2 across the codebase.
- Updated logger types (log.Logger to logging.EventLogger).
- Adjusted test logger initialization (NewTestLogger, NewNopLogger) to use ipfs/go-log/v2 equivalents with appropriate log levels.
- Replaced logger.With("module", "name") with logging.Logger("name") for subsystem loggers.
- Removed direct usage of rs/zerolog for log level parsing.
- Ensured all automated tests pass after the migration.
